Key Nutrients for Bermuda Grass

When delving into the world of Bermuda grass care, it becomes evident that certain key nutrients play a pivotal role in ensuring its health and vibrancy. Nitrogen, phosphorus, and potassium stand out as the primary macronutrients crucial for Bermuda grass' growth and development. Nitrogen aids in lush green foliage, phosphorus supports robust root development, and potassium contributes to overall plant health and resilience.

Nitrogen, phosphorus, and potassium, also known as NPK, form the backbone of any good fertilizer regimen for Bermuda grass care in Florida. Understanding the specific roles of each nutrient is essential. Nitrogen facilitates photosynthesis and chlorophyll production, enhancing the grass's green color. Phosphorus boosts root growth and flower development, ensuring a sturdy and healthy Bermuda grass lawn. Meanwhile, potassium assists in overall plant vigor and disease resistance, crucial for withstanding Florida's climatic challenges.

Micronutrients Requirements

Apart from the primary macronutrients, micronutrients are also vital for Bermuda grass to flourish. These micronutrients, such as iron, manganese, and zinc, though required in smaller quantities, are no less essential for ensuring the overall well-being and resilience of Bermuda grass. Micronutrient deficiencies can manifest as discoloration, stunted growth, and increased susceptibility to pests and diseases, underscoring the indispensable nature of these lesser-known nutrients.

Slow-Release vs. Quick-Release Fertilizers

The choice between slow-release and quick-release fertilizers is a decision that impacts the long-term health and sustainability of Bermuda grass. Slow-release fertilizers gradually supply nutrients to the grass over an extended period, promoting steady growth and minimizing the risk of nutrient leaching. On the other hand, quick-release fertilizers provide an immediate nutrient boost to the grass but require more frequent applications. Understanding the dosage, frequency, and environmental factors are crucial when deciding between these two fertilizer types to ensure optimal nutrient absorption by the grass.

Timing and Frequency of Application

Determining the appropriate timing and frequency of fertilizer application is crucial for sustaining Bermuda grass in Florida. It is recommended to fertilize Bermuda grass during its peak growing seasons, typically in late spring and early summer, to maximize nutrient uptake and utilization. Additionally, applying fertilizer every 6-8 weeks helps maintain a consistent supply of essential nutrients for the grass to flourish.

Proper Application Techniques

Utilizing proper application techniques is key to effectively deliver nutrients to Bermuda grass roots for optimal absorption. When applying fertilizer, ensure even distribution across the lawn to prevent patchy growth. Using a calibrated spreader can aid in achieving uniform coverage and prevent the risk of over-fertilization in certain areas.

Avoiding Over-Fertilization

One of the critical aspects of fertilizer application is avoiding over-fertilization, which can have detrimental effects on Bermuda grass health. Over-fertilizing can lead to excessive growth, making the grass more susceptible to diseases and pests. To prevent over-fertilization, carefully follow recommended application rates and avoid applying more fertilizer than necessary. Regularly monitor the condition of your grass to avoid signs of stress or nutrient imbalance caused by over-fertilization.

Watering practices play a pivotal role in maintaining Bermuda grass health. Florida's hot and often dry climate necessitates a strategic approach to watering to prevent both under-watering and over-watering, which can both have detrimental effects on Bermuda grass. Establishing a consistent watering schedule, particularly during drier periods, is key to promoting deep root growth and overall health of the grass. Additionally, utilizing proper irrigation techniques and equipment is vital to ensure adequate water penetration without causing waterlogging.

When it comes to mowing Bermuda grass, certain tips can contribute to its overall health and vigor. Maintaining the correct mowing height is critical, as cutting the grass too short can weaken it and make it more susceptible to stress and diseases. It is advisable to adhere to the one-third rule, which recommends never cutting more than one-third of the grass blade's height in a single mowing session. Furthermore, keeping mower blades sharp to achieve clean cuts and avoiding mowing wet grass can help prevent damage and promote healthier regrowth.
